Skin lightening product "White - Lightening Beauty was recalled on 14 October 2011 under EU Safety Gate alert 1108/11. Chemical risk reported by Portugal. The product poses a chemical risk because it contains, as declared on the label, the ingredient hydroquinone, which may have carcinogenic effects.

Risk Description
The product poses a chemical risk because it contains, as declared on the label, the ingredient hydroquinone, which may have carcinogenic effects.The product does not comply with the Cosmetics Directive 76/768/EEC.
Product Description
White and orange plastic bottle with orange screw cap and orange and black print. The packaging bears the list of ingredients and indications in Portuguese, French and English. Volume 500 ml.
